ROASTED FENNEL AND PARSNIP SOUP
This thick and rich soup has a fresh flavour with a hint of licorice from the fennel. Roasting the vegetables softens their flavour and adds a unique taste to this elegant soup.

Steps:
- Cut top frawns off fennel and cut bulb in half. Cut out core and slice thinly. In a large bowl toss together fennel, parsnips with oil, garlic and curry powder. Spread onto parchment paper lined baking sheet and roast in preheated 400 F (200 C) oven for about 30 minutes or until tender and golden.
- Scrape vegetable into saucepan and add 3 cups (750 mL) of the broth. Bring to a simmer and simmer for 10 minutes. Using an immersion blender, puree soup slightly. Stir in dill and remaining broth and heat through.

PARSNIP AND FENNEL SOUP
There is magic when you blend several vegetables together in a pureed soup. Amazingly, you can taste all of the individual ingredients. The nuance is very elegant and very satisfying. Soups of this nature are really easy to make. An immersion blender is really your best friend here. Being able to process the soup in the same pot you used to cook in is really the ultimate convenience. (Do not use an immersion blender in a non-stick pan....use only with stainless steel.) Steps:
- Place parsnips, fennel, celery, potatoes, bouillon, and water in a large pot and put on burner over medium heat to come to a boil.
- Meanwhile, in a small saute pan, heat the butter and saute the shallots until clear. Add the wine and white pepper. Turn heat up and reduce until the liquid is mostly evaporated. Add shallots to the large pot with the other vegetables.
- Once the large pot has come to a full boil, reduce to simmer, covered for 1 hour.
- Remove soup from heat and cool sufficiently before pureeing with an immersion blender (or in batches in a blender).
- Serve hot with some cracked pepper and bread of choice. I like this soup with fresh, hot popovers.
- Optional: you may reheat this soup with some heavy cream and adjust salt and pepper....but it is delicious, in it's lower calorie version, served plain.
- This recipe yields about 12 cups of soup.

Steps:
- Combine the fennel, leek, bay leaf, vegetable bouillon, and water in a pressure cooker. Lock the lid of the pressure cooker, bring it up to pressure, reduce heat to maintain pressure, and cook for 15 minutes. Remove cooker from the heat and let the pressure reduce on its own, 5 to 10 minutes. If your pressure cooker does not have a quick-release function, reduce cooking time slightly as food will continue to cook while pressure releases slowly.
- Stir the olive oil into the soup, and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ese to serve.

Steps:
- Heat the butter and olive oil in a. Add in the onion and garlic and fry gently, stirring often, without browning, for 5 minutes.
- Mix in the cumin, then add in the parsnip and fennel, stirring well.
- Add in the broth, bring to the boil, reduce the heat and simmer for 15-20 minutes until the parsnips and fennel are tender. Season with salt and freshly ground pepper.
- Cool slightly, then blend until smooth using a hand or jug blender.
- Reheat gently over a low heat.
- Ladle into serving bowls and garnish each portion with a swirl cream or yogurt if you wish.
